Steven Spielberg, Tom Hanks, and Gary Goetzman's third most awaited collaboration, Masters of the Air took the internet by storm after Apple TV+ unveiled its first trailer on November 9, and fans are overwhelmed with Austin Butler's look in the period drama. Previously the executive producers had delivered together Band of Brothers and The Pacific.

Cast and Plot

The charismatic Austin Butler and Fantastic Beasts fame Callum Turner lead the ensemble cast of Masters of the Air. The stellar cast also includes Anthony Boyle, Nate Mann, Rafferty Law, Barry Keoghan, Josiah Cross, Branden Cook, and Ncuti Gatwa in prominent roles.

Based on Donald L. Miller's popular book, Masters of the Air, is penned by John Orloff. This period drama revolves around a group of men of the 100th Bomb Group, aka the Bloody Hundredth on the dangerous mission of bomb raids to destroy Hitler’s Third Reich in Nazi-occupied Germany as they battle the extreme weather conditions, oxygen shortage, and war atrocity amid the brutal aerial combat, a thousand feet above in the sky.

When and Where to watch

The nine-episodic mini-series, executively produced by Spielberg, Hanks, and Gary Goetzman will begin its World War II journey on the streaming platform Apple TV+ on January 26, next year.
